PK-5 Mini Signal Latching Relay – 2A 30VDC 8Pins for Precision Switching

Product Overview

The PK-5 series is a compact mini signal latching relay (bistable relay) designed for low-power, high-reliability applications. Rated at 2A 30VDC and available in an 8-pin DIP configuration, the PK-5 consumes only 0.3~0.43W coil power and maintains its contact state without continuous coil energization – ideal for battery-powered and energy-sensitive systems. This Latching Relay offers excellent low-level switching capability (10~50μA, 10~50mV), fast operate/release time (≤4ms), and hermetic sealing (≤10⁻³ Pa·cm³/s) for harsh environments. Technical Specifications

Coil Parameters (Latching Type)

  • Coil power consumption: (0.3~0.43)W – pulse operation only
  • Nominal coil voltage: 3V, 5V, 6V, 9V, 12V, 24V DC (specify when ordering)
  • Incentive pulse width: (10~50) ms – sufficient to switch state
  • Coil resistance: Refer to datasheet for exact values per voltage

Contact Ratings

  • Maximum switching current: 2A at 30V DC (resistive load)
  • Reference resistive load: 1A, 28V DC, 1×10⁵ operations
  • Low level switching capability: (10~50)μA, (10~50)mV – 1×10⁵ operations, ideal for dry circuit applications
  • Initial contact resistance: ≤50mΩ; after life test ≤200mΩ

Timing & Dielectric

  • Action time (operate): ≤4ms (typical ≤3ms)
  • Release time: ≤4ms
  • Dielectric strength (normal atmosphere): 500Vr.m.s., 50Hz; under low pressure: 250Vr.m.s., 50Hz
  • Insulation resistance (normal atmosphere): >500MΩ; after high-level life test: >50MΩ

Mechanical & Environmental

  • Weight: <3g – ultra-light for PCB mounting
  • Sealing (leakage rate): ≤10⁻³ Pa·cm³/s (hermetic, glass-to-metal seal)
  • Operating temperature range: -40°C to +85°C
  • Terminal style: 8-pin DIP (standard 2.54mm pitch)

All parameters are validated at 25°C ambient. The PK-5 meets MIL-R-39016/6 specifications for signal relay applications.

Key Features & Advantages

  • True latching (bistable) operation: Dual-coil or single-coil with polarity reversal – retains contact state after pulse ends. Zero holding power consumption reduces system energy use by >90% compared to non-latching relays.
  • Ultra-low coil power (0.3~0.43W): Compatible with battery-powered and energy-harvesting devices – ideal for remote sensors, IoT nodes, and portable instruments.
  • Excellent low-level signal switching: Reliably switches dry circuits down to 10μA / 10mV – no contact oxidation or false openings, perfect for test & measurement and medical electronics.
  • Hermetic sealing (≤10⁻³ Pa·cm³/s): Protects contacts from humidity, dust, and corrosive gases – ensures stable contact resistance over decades of service.
  • Fast switching (≤4ms) & high insulation: 500Vrms dielectric strength and >500MΩ insulation resistance – suitable for isolating sensitive analog signals.
  • Standard 8-pin DIP footprint: Drop-in replacement for many industry-standard signal latching relays (e.g., G6A, TQ2-L, etc.).

How to Use the PK-5 Latching Relay – Step by Step

  1. Identify coil configuration: The PK-5 is typically a dual-coil latching relay (set coil and reset coil) or single-coil with polarity-sensitive operation. Refer to the datasheet for your specific part number.
  2. Apply set pulse: To close the contacts (e.g., from common to NO), apply a DC voltage equal to the nominal coil voltage (e.g., 5V) to the set coil pins for 10-50 ms. Do not exceed the rated pulse width to avoid overheating.
  3. State retention: After the pulse ends, the relay remains in the closed state indefinitely without any coil power. This is the key advantage of a Latching Relay.
  4. Apply reset pulse: To open the contacts, apply a DC voltage (same nominal value) to the reset coil pins for 10-50 ms. The relay will return to its open state.
  5. Load connection: Connect your low-level signal or small power load (max 2A 30VDC) to the common and normally-open terminals. For dry circuit applications (μA/mV levels), no special contact treatment is needed – the PK-5’s gold-plated contacts ensure reliable switching.
  6. PCB mounting: Insert the 8-pin DIP package into a standard IC socket or solder directly to the PCB. Wave soldering is allowed (260°C max for 5 seconds).

Pro tip: If using a single-coil latching version, reverse the polarity of the pulse to reset the relay. A simple H-bridge driver or two MOSFETs can generate the bipolar pulse from a single supply.

Application Scenarios & Key Buyer Benefits

Typical High-Reliability & Low-Power Uses

  • Avionics & military electronics: Hermetic sealing and wide temperature range make the PK-5 suitable for cockpit controls, radar systems, and missile guidance circuits.
  • Smart energy meters (AMI): Latching operation allows utility meters to disconnect/reconnect power without draining the backup battery – extends battery life by years.
  • Medical devices (patient monitors, infusion pumps): Low-level signal capability ensures accurate switching of ECG/EEG leads without introducing noise.
  • Telecommunications & network switches: Bistable relays hold line configuration during power loss – critical for fail-safe operation.
  • Industrial control & automation: PLC output modules, test equipment multiplexers, and data acquisition systems benefit from the relay’s long mechanical life (≥1×10⁷ operations).

Production Process & Quality Assurance

YM’s signal relay production line is designed for precision and repeatability, combining automated assembly with rigorous in-process inspections.

  • Incoming material control: 100% inspection of magnetic cores, copper wire, contact alloys, and glass-to-metal seals – sourced from certified partners.
  • Coil winding & encapsulation: Toroidal winding with automatic resistance monitoring; vacuum encapsulation for void-free insulation.
  • Contact assembly in Class 100 cleanroom: Precision adjustment of contact gap and overtravel using laser micrometer – ensures consistent contact resistance.
  • Hermetic sealing & leak detection: Resistance welding under inert gas atmosphere; 100% helium mass spectrometry leak test (≤10⁻³ Pa·cm³/s).
  • Dynamic functional test: Every relay is pulsed with set/reset voltages while measuring operate time, contact bounce, and contact voltage drop at 2A 30VDC.
  • Environmental sample testing: Each batch undergoes thermal shock (-55°C to +125°C, 10 cycles), random vibration (20-2000Hz, 10g), and 1000-hour 85°C/85% RH life test.
